Amravati

Located in the Tapi basin and right in the centre of the northern border of Maharashtra, Amravati is the mainAmravati town of the district of the same name. According to legends, Amravati, or Land of the Immortals, belonged to Lord Indra, the king of gods. This place is known for its extreme climates with hot summers and cold winters and has many orange orchards. The city, which is also an important centre for the cotton belt, is developing at a rapid pace. Amaravati is an important Buddhist site located near the ancient Satavahana capital, Dhanyakataka, is now called Amaravati.It was one of the four renowned Buddhist centers of learning in the country which attracted students from all over the world.It gave fillip to art, architecture, trade, and facilitated the spread of Buddhism on the east coast.Today in South India, Buddhists consider it the most sacred pilgrim centre. Many years ago, an emissary of Emperor Ashoka, who went to propagate Buddhism in this region, laid the foundation of the Great Stupa at Amaravati. We provide tourist transport in India.

The dome, now missing, seems to have been built solidly of large-sized bricks measuring 57 x 28 x 7.6 cm. presently it has a height of about 1.55 m and a diameter of 49.30 m.The stupa may well have been the one to have the largest marble-surfaced dome in the world! The dome and the outer and inner sides of the railing were richly adorned with carvings, depicting events from the life of Buddha. Sightseeing Highlights:
Ambadevi temple that is dedicated to Goddess Amba is the main attraction here and has a lot of devotees coming in each day.The Melghat and Wan sanctuaries are popular wildlife reserves, mainly famous for the tiger, but they have several other birds and animals as well. Within Melghat, the core reserve area is known as

Gugarnal National Park.
The region also has the Chikhaldara hill station, which is the only hill station in the Vidharba region.
Other nearby attractions include Gawilgarh Fort, the wall of which has undergone a fantastic restoration project by experts from Nagpur, and a few other temples.

Other Activities:
You can go for boating and picnics at Chhatri Talao, which is a reservoir on the outskirts of Amravati. Wadali Talao, which has a zoo and also boating facilities, is another popular weekend place.

Amravati Tourist Attractions
Amravati has some very prominent tourism sites like Shri Amba Devi temple, Melghat Tiger Project and Chikhaldara.

Amba Devi Temple:

Melghat Tiger Project:
This wild life park situated at Satpura Mountains with a dense forest of teak and bamboo.
